| Description: | The Upper Paraguay Basin (BAP, Portuguese acronym) is an ecosystem of strategic importance to Brazil because it includes the Pantanal, one of the world's largest floodplains. The wet plain is well preserved, but the plateau suffered the impact of anthropic activities on the natural resources, due to the rapid conversion of vegetation cover in recent decades. Therefore, it is essential to investigate land use and cover changes to define strategies that stimulate environmental conservation and regional development. The BAP plateau region is covered by the mappings of the TerraClass Project, which provides official data for monitoring land use and cover in the Amazon and Cerrado biomes. In this context, the objective of the work was to analyze changes in land use and land cover in municipalities of the BAP, using the modern GeoPortal TerraClass and the recent data collection from 2018, 2020, and 2022. The spatial analysis showed that the native forest loss occurred due to increased deforestation. Most of the forest regeneration areas persisted during this period, and the lost area was converted into pastures, where agriculture expanded, initially with one cycle production, followed by the intensification of crop and off-season production. The results demonstrate the potential of the data and tools offered by the Digital Platform TerraClass to support territorial management. |
